In Florida, psychotherapists who wish to work as Sex Therapists must meet specific educational requirements as described in Florida Law.
Rule 64B4-7.004 (2005) Use of the Title "Sex Therapist" -- "Any licensed clinical social worker, marriage and family therapist, or mental health counselor who holds himself out as a sex therapist shall have completed a minimum of 120 hours of approved education and twenty (20) hours of clinical case supervision." The Institute is also an approved provider of sex therapy training by the American Association of Sexuality Educators, Counselors and Therapists (AASECT).
The One-Year Training Institute meets monthly for one year to offer the complete 120-hour curriculum. Twenty (20) hours of Individual and Group Clinical Case Supervision is also completed within the one year.

Jefferson University has a Master’s degree in family therapy and offers a sex therapy track. This program is organized in collaboration by Jefferson University and Council For Relationships. The sex therapy track is offered as an elective of the couple and family therapy program. In addition to the family therapy courses there are three courses in sex therapy offered in conjunction with Sexual Attitude Reassessment (SAR) experience. The program also includes a sex therapy practicum, which can be at the Institute of Sex Therapy, as well as supervision. Typically the program can be completed in 2 years if it is done as a full-time student.

Widener University offers a Human Sexuality Education program. Depending on your interests and specialization you may opt for a MEd or EdD in Human Sexuality. This unique program also allows students to pursue a combination degree Widener’s Center for Social Work Education or Institute for Graduate Clinical Psychology; therefore, students may earn either an MSW/MEd or PsyD/MEd. There are many joint degrees you may choose to seek at Widener as the human sexuality specialization is offered in several forms (social work, education, and clinical psychology). Both degrees are a great start for a career in sex therapy as the program has been approved by the American Association of Sexuality Educators, Counselors, and Therapists (AASECT) for meeting their certificate requirements.
Widener is the only accredited doctoral human sexuality education program in the United States as it meets APA (American Psychological Association) standards.
